# Night-shift access — Support team

Applies to Veldspar Systems support staff, 22:00–06:00. Main lobby is locked; enter via the east stairwell door at Copperbeam House. Badge in at the reader, then again at the level 4 support floor. No tailgating. Log any access failures in the Nightboard channel before calling facilities. If the reader is down, use the manual keypad with this code:

staff pass of kagup-fajog = bdg-QCHVQW-99665837

Hey Priya — handing off KeyTumbler, our little secrets-rotation utility, before I'm out. It rotates vault entries nightly and pings the #rotation channel on failure. New folks: don't touch the scheduler cron unless staging is green. Logs live under the usual ops bucket. Everything it needs at startup is listed in the config block below.

service settings:
[ulamir]
port = 4000
region = central-4
host = ulamir.norvaworks.corp
timeout_ms = 2000
retries = 4

## Releases

New tide-table widget versions for Shoreline ship roughly monthly. Plugin authors: pin to a minor version, because tidal interpolation internals move around between releases. Changelogs live in the repo, and breaking changes always get a heads-up one release early. Every published bundle is signed; verify downloads against the key directly below.

signing key of yajog-kafof = bky19_orbYRY3Abj3KpZesMie